Through this tutorial you will learn how to enable remote play on any android smartphone and tablet even if it isn't a Sony product.

Read the whole tutorial once before starting to avoid inconvenience or misunderstanding.

You will need :
- A smartphone or tablet on Android 4.0 in CFW (no matter the which one).
- Your smartphone must be ROOT.
- Your smartphone must have a CWM RECOVERY or TWRP.
- A PS4

Now follow these steps :

- Download this pack : https://www.mediafire.com/?aei7t385h5avt16

- Extract the pack archive you just downloaded to your desktop.

- Open the folder of the extracted file.

- Open the folder “files to flash via RECOVERY”.

- Copy the file, PS4 Remote Play Port 4.0 + zip to your smartphone to the root folder:
Android/SDCARD

- Restart your smartphone in RECOVERY mode.

- Via RECOVERY, flash your file: PS4 Remote Play Port 4.0 + .zip

- Now do a Wipe Cache and Dalvik Cache. (If you don’t know how to do this, you can find how to do it easily by searching in the internet (Google is your friend)).

- Restart your smartphone.

- Copy the file: playstationapp.apk in your smartphone, and install it. (Remember to check: Unknown Source)

- Launch the application PlaystationApp and click Remote Play button.

- Wait for the connection to your PS4.

- You can now remote play your ps4 games to your smartphone.

Someone took the files meant to be exclusive to Sony's Xperia Z3 which has the ability to support remote play similar to the PS Vita and ported it over to any android device on 4.0+ so long as it's rooted.
